MENOMONIE BICYCLE/PEDESTRIAN ADVISORY COMMITTEE
(BPAC)
January 23, 2023
The Menomonie Bicycle/Pedestrian Advisory Committee met on January 23,
2023 at 6:00PM in the Council Chambers (800 Wilson Ave). Committee
members in attendance included: David Williams, Mark Deyo Svendson,
Mark Mastalir, Kate Kramschuster and Logan Mather. Also in attendance:
Bob Colson, Burton Barnhart, John Wesolek, and Lowell Prange.
Chairperson Mather opened the meeting. MOTION by Kramschuster,
seconded by Williams, to approve the July 25, 2022 minutes. MOTION
passed.
Colson reviewed a memo he prepared relating to the Bicycle Friendly
Community Certification requirements. A number of these activities
may need to be undertaken and accomplished to maintain the bronze
level before the 2026 application is submitted. Also adding equity
and accessibility as a goal to engage underrepresented community
members could provide additional points to future applications.
Kramschuster expressed a desire to get more community involvement to
reach committee goals. Input from the Chamber/Tourism, School
District, Dunn County, etc. would be helpful to complete some of the
program objectives.
Williams suggested a future Bike Federation Summit be held in
Menomonie. It was also suggested that a representative of the
Wisconsin Bike Federation attend a future committee meeting.
Under BPAC concerns, there were general concerns regarding the
condition of the bicycle trail adjacent to Stokke Parkway and the
south end of Junction Trail.
With no further business, the meeting was adjourned by the Chair. Next
meeting is scheduled for April 24, 2023 at 6:00pm.
